The financial industry is evolving faster than ever. From mobile banking to AI-driven investment platforms, financial technology—commonly known as fintech—has transformed how individuals and businesses manage money. Companies entering this space must prioritize innovation, security, compliance, and user experience. In this comprehensive Fintech Software Development Guide, we’ll explore everything you need to know about building scalable and secure fintech solutions.

For businesses seeking expert development services, partnering with experienced fintech specialists like https://digineat.com/ can accelerate the journey from idea to successful product launch.

What Is Fintech Software Development?

Fintech software development refers to the process of designing, developing, and maintaining digital solutions for financial services. These include:

  • Mobile banking applications
  • Digital wallets
  • Payment gateways
  • Cryptocurrency platforms
  • Lending and crowdfunding systems
  • Insurtech platforms
  • Investment and trading applications

The goal of fintech development is to enhance financial services through automation, accessibility, and improved efficiency.

Why Fintech Is Growing Rapidly

The global demand for digital financial services continues to surge. Several factors drive this growth:

1. Digital Transformation

Consumers expect seamless digital experiences. Traditional banks are adopting fintech innovations to stay competitive.

2. Mobile Penetration

Smartphones allow users to manage finances anywhere, anytime.

3. AI and Automation

Artificial intelligence improves fraud detection, credit scoring, and personalized financial advice.

4. Blockchain Technology

Blockchain enhances transparency, reduces fraud, and speeds up transactions.

Businesses entering fintech must understand these trends to build competitive and future-ready solutions.

Key Features of Fintech Applications

To build a successful fintech product, certain features are essential:

1. Strong Security Measures

Security is the backbone of fintech development. Essential elements include:

  • Data encryption
  • Multi-factor authentication (MFA)
  • Biometric login
  • Secure APIs
  • Fraud detection systems

2. Regulatory Compliance

Fintech companies must comply with regulations such as:

  • KYC (Know Your Customer)
  • AML (Anti-Money Laundering)
  • GDPR (General Data Protection Regulation)
  • PCI-DSS for payment security

Failure to meet regulatory requirements can result in heavy penalties.

3. Seamless User Experience (UX/UI)

Users expect intuitive interfaces. Complex financial systems must feel simple and accessible.

4. Real-Time Processing

Instant transactions, notifications, and account updates are critical for user trust.

5. API Integration

Modern fintech solutions rely on APIs to integrate with banks, payment processors, and third-party services.

Types of Fintech Solutions

Understanding the different fintech categories helps businesses choose the right development strategy.

Digital Banking Platforms

Neobanks and online banking apps provide full financial services without physical branches.

Payment Solutions

Payment gateways and digital wallets facilitate fast and secure online transactions.

Lending Platforms

Peer-to-peer lending systems connect borrowers with investors.

Wealth Management Apps

Investment apps use AI to provide automated portfolio management.

Cryptocurrency and Blockchain Platforms

These platforms enable digital asset trading, decentralized finance (DeFi), and secure transactions.

Each type requires specialized development expertise and strict security implementation.

Fintech Software Development Process

Building fintech software requires a structured and strategic approach.

1. Market Research and Planning

Start by identifying:

  • Target audience
  • Market demand
  • Competitor analysis
  • Regulatory landscape

Clear planning reduces risks and improves product-market fit.

2. Define Core Features

Focus on essential features for your Minimum Viable Product (MVP). Launching an MVP allows early feedback and cost control.

3. UI/UX Design

Design user-friendly interfaces that simplify complex financial operations.

4. Backend and Frontend Development

  • Frontend: React, Angular, or Vue for responsive user interfaces.
  • Backend: Node.js, Python, Java, or .NET for secure and scalable systems.
  • Database: PostgreSQL, MongoDB, or MySQL.

5. Security Implementation

Security must be integrated at every stage of development—not added later.

6. Testing and Quality Assurance

Fintech applications require extensive testing, including:

  • Security testing
  • Performance testing
  • Load testing
  • Compliance testing

7. Deployment and Maintenance

After launch, continuous monitoring and updates are crucial to maintain performance and security.

Professional fintech developers like https://digineat.com/ ensure smooth development, compliance adherence, and long-term scalability.

Technologies Used in Fintech Development

Artificial Intelligence (AI)

Used for fraud detection, credit scoring, and predictive analytics.

Blockchain

Enhances transparency and security in transactions.

Cloud Computing

Provides scalability, cost-efficiency, and secure data storage.

Big Data Analytics

Helps financial institutions analyze customer behavior and reduce risk.

Robotic Process Automation (RPA)

Automates repetitive financial tasks, improving efficiency.

Selecting the right technology stack directly impacts performance and user trust.

Security Challenges in Fintech

Fintech platforms face unique security challenges:

  • Data breaches
  • Identity theft
  • Phishing attacks
  • Transaction fraud
  • Insider threats

To combat these risks, developers implement:

  • End-to-end encryption
  • Zero-trust architecture
  • Regular security audits
  • AI-powered fraud detection

Security is not optional—it is mandatory in fintech development.

Benefits of Investing in Fintech Software

1. Increased Efficiency

Automation reduces manual processes and operational costs.

2. Enhanced Customer Experience

Users enjoy faster, more convenient financial services.

3. Global Reach

Digital platforms eliminate geographical limitations.

4. Better Risk Management

AI and analytics provide improved risk assessment.

5. Competitive Advantage

Innovative fintech solutions attract tech-savvy customers.

Businesses that adopt fintech solutions early often outperform competitors in both revenue and customer loyalty.

Cost of Fintech Software Development

The cost depends on:

  • Complexity of features
  • Security requirements
  • Regulatory compliance
  • Technology stack
  • Development team expertise

A simple fintech app may cost significantly less than a fully featured digital banking platform. However, cutting corners on security or compliance can lead to costly consequences later.

Investing in experienced fintech developers ensures long-term savings and sustainable growth.

Future Trends in Fintech Development

The fintech industry continues to evolve. Emerging trends include:

  • Embedded finance
  • Open banking
  • AI-powered financial advisors
  • Decentralized finance (DeFi)
  • Biometric authentication
  • RegTech solutions

Businesses that adapt to these trends will remain competitive in the coming years.

Final Thoughts

Fintech software development is not just about building an app—it’s about creating secure, scalable, and user-centric financial ecosystems. From compliance and security to AI integration and seamless user experiences, every aspect must be carefully planned and executed.

As digital finance continues to expand globally, businesses must partner with reliable development experts to navigate complex regulations and advanced technologies. Whether you’re launching a startup or modernizing an existing financial institution, strategic fintech development is the key to success.

TIME BUSINESS NEWS

JS Bin